Amazon triples operating profit in Q1 2024

Amazon publishes its results for the first quarter of 2024, providing insights into the company’s continued dominance in e-commerce. Here are the highlights:

  • Q1 revenue was $143.3 billion, up 12.5% year over year. Of this, 1.2% is attributable to the leap day at the end of February.

  • Operating profit more than tripled from USD 4.8 billion to USD 15.3 billion.

Shein is now also a ‘very large online platform’ under the DSA

The Chinese online fashion platform Shein is confronted with stricter EU regulations from the DSA, which primarily targets very large online platforms.

  • Among other things, the fast fashion giant must now take tougher action against counterfeit products.

  • To this end, the company must submit an annual risk assessment report in which it sets out the impact of its activities on the health and safety of its customers.

How Babor increased its e-commerce conversions by 82% with AI

Babor, a leading provider of skincare products, has achieved an impressive increase in online conversion rates with AI-powered personalisation.

  • The focus is on a skin type consultation called ‘Skin Advisor’, which provides AI-supported recommendations based on age, customer input and geolocation, and the ‘Skin Coach’, which can be used to monitor the desired skincare goals.

  • In the fourth quarter, customers who tried the Skin Coach achieved an 82% higher conversion rate and a 19% higher order value.

  • According to Glossy.co, the conversion rate for customers who used both tools was 442% higher than for customers who used neither.
